Abstract :
The oxidation of vanadium nitride (VN) and titanium nitride (TiN) coatings in ultra-high vacuum has been investigated in situ by X-ray photoelectron spectroscopy. On the VN coatings mixed oxide layers containing V3+ and V4+ species form at elevated temperatures (⩾600°C) and at high oxygen exposures, which cover completely the VN surface. Under similar oxidation conditions the TiN surface oxidises partially to a mixture of TiO2 and Ti oxynitride (TiOxNy) phases. This oxidation behaviour has been correlated to the tribological properties of the VN and TiN coatings investigated recently.
